
Flying a drone near an airport is risky, as manned aircraft may struggle to see and avoid your drone. While it is not illegal to fly a drone near an uncontrolled airport, there are several precautions you must take. Firstly, you must avoid manned aircraft and be responsible for any safety hazards your drone creates. Secondly, you must understand the difference between controlled and uncontrolled airspace and where you can legally fly. Controlled airspace is found around some airports and altitudes where air traffic controllers actively communicate with, direct, and separate all air traffic. Uncontrolled airspace refers to airspace where air traffic controllers are not directing air traffic within its limits. Drone operators can fly in uncontrolled airspace below 400 feet above the ground without authorization, but anything higher requires FAA authorization.

Drone operators must avoid manned aircraft and are responsible for any safety hazards
Drone operators must always avoid manned aircraft and are responsible for any safety hazards their drone creates in an airport environment. This is because it is difficult for manned aircraft to see and avoid a drone while flying. Drone operators must also be aware of the traffic pattern of the airport they are flying near, and understand that they must yield the right of way to manned aircraft. For example, if a drone operator sees a plane approaching for landing, they must either land their drone or change their position or altitude to safely avoid the manned aircraft's flight path.
Drone operators should also be aware of the altitude restrictions in place. In most cases, it is illegal for a manned aircraft to fly lower than 500 feet outside of landing at an airfield. Drone operators should stay below 400 feet and listen for engines, as they will hear them long before there is a collision danger. However, it is important to note that the typical pattern altitude for manned aircraft is 1,000 feet. Therefore, drone operators should be cautious and familiarize themselves with the traffic pattern in all wind conditions.
Drone operators should also be aware of any uncontrolled airspace, which does not require FAA authorization to operate a drone up to 400 feet AGL. This information can be found on the B4UFLY platform, which provides real-time airspace data to ensure the desired operation is safe and compliant. However, it is important to note that even in uncontrolled airspace, drone operators must still follow the rules and regulations regarding drone operations, including yielding the right of way to all other aircraft.

Drone operators must receive authorisation to fly in controlled airspace
Drone pilots can request authorisation to operate in controlled airspace through the FAA's LAANC or Drone Zone platforms. Drone Zone provides authorisations for airports that are not LAANC-enabled, while LAANC offers near-real-time authorisations through FAA-approved companies. To receive authorisation, drone pilots may need to pass the Recreational UAS Safety Test (TRUST) and meet other requirements, such as registering their drone and adhering to altitude restrictions.
It is important to note that drone operators are responsible for any safety hazards their drone creates in an airport environment. Therefore, drone operators should always yield the right of way to manned aircraft and maintain an altitude below 400 feet to reduce the risk of collisions. Additionally, drone pilots should familiarise themselves with the airport's traffic patterns and exercise caution when flying near airports.
While operating in controlled airspace requires authorisation, some airspace classifications do not require prior approval. For instance, small airports located in Class G uncontrolled airspace and certain types of Class E airspace do not mandate FAA authorisation for drone operations up to 400 feet above ground level. However, even in uncontrolled airspace, drone operators must remain vigilant and adhere to safety precautions.

Smaller airports are often located in Class G uncontrolled airspace
Drone operators do not need FAA authorization to fly in Class G airspace up to 400 ft AGL. However, drone operators must avoid manned aircraft and are responsible for any safety hazards their drone creates. If you see a plane approaching for landing at the airport, you must either land your drone or change your position or altitude to avoid the manned aircraft's flight path.
In Class G airspace, there are no entry or communication requirements. However, it is recommended that you communicate your position at all times. Radio communication is not required, even for IFR operations. There are minimum weather requirements so that you can see and avoid other aircraft and stay out of the clouds. Below 10,000 feet MSL, there is no required equipment. But if you're 10,000 feet MSL or higher, and more than 2,500 feet AGL, you'll need a Mode-C transponder.

Drone operators should contact the airport manager before flying near uncontrolled airports
Drone operators are responsible for staying away from manned aircraft and avoiding safety hazards. It is difficult for manned aircraft to see and avoid a drone while flying, and drone operators must be vigilant about maintaining a safe altitude. In most cases, it is illegal for a manned aircraft to fly lower than 500 feet outside of landing at an airfield. Drone operators should stay below 400 feet and listen for engines, which can be heard long before there is a collision risk.
Drone operators should familiarize themselves with the airport's traffic patterns and other useful information that can help them fly safely. Understanding the different operations that take place at each airport is essential. For example, 97% of LAX's 1,500 flights per day are commercial operations, while over 99% of daily traffic at French Valley Airport is general aviation.
Drone operators should also be aware of the different classifications of airspace. Only airports located in Class A, B, C, D, & E2 controlled airspace require LAANC authorizations to operate near or around. Many smaller airports are located in Class G uncontrolled airspace, meaning no LAANC authorization is needed to operate near or around them. Some small airports are located under Class E controlled airspace but do not require prior authorization since the controlled airspace starts at 700 feet AGL.
